The collapse of the Hongqi Bridge in southwest China has raised significant concerns regarding infrastructure safety and construction standards in a region prone to geological instability. Opened just months ago, the bridge measured an impressive 2,487 feet in length, connecting Sichuan province to Tibet. The incident occurred Tuesday, following an emergency closure prompted by visible ground cracks and the potential for landslides.
Authorities acted swiftly, removing vehicles from the bridge and blocking traffic a day before the collapse. Thankfully, there were no reported injuries. The quick response highlights the importance of monitoring structural health, especially in such a susceptible area. The emergency measures taken may have prevented a much more significant disaster.
This incident is not isolated. It follows a troubling trend of bridge failures in China. Just months prior, twelve workers lost their lives when a railway bridge in Qinghai province collapsed during construction. Earlier in July, another bridge failure claimed at least eleven lives. These events have sparked serious questions about long-term construction standards, particularly in China’s western provinces, where infrastructure projects often confront challenging terrain.
Critics point to a possible decline in quality control amid China’s shifting approach to infrastructure investment. Once celebrated for massive expenditures on roads and railways, the Chinese government now faces scrutiny over the declining reliability of its projects. Newsweek reports that no longer is the emphasis solely on quantity; quality must come to the forefront, particularly in seismically active areas like Sichuan.
